How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Howard University?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Howard University Studio Apartments | $2,104 | $1,150 | $5,726 |
Howard University 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,709 | $868 | $8,002 |
Howard University 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,607 | $1,281 | $10,000+ |
Howard University 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,731 | $1,225 | $10,000+ |
Howard University 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,781 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Furnished Howard University Apartments
What is the Cheapest Furnished apartment in Howard University?
Currently the most affordable Furnished Apartment in Howard University is at Monroe (Furnished Rooms) listed at $1,150.
How much is the average rent for a Furnished Howard University Apartment?
The average rent for a Furnished Apartment in Howard University is $3,078.
What is the largest Furnished Howard University Apartment for rent?
Today's Furnished apartment with the most square footage in Howard University is a 2,225 square feet unit starting from $7,430 at 727 Kenyon St NW, Unit A.
What is the average size for Howard University Furnished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Furnished rental in Howard University is currently at 568 sq ft.
